What has actually changed lately in CPR

The principles do not swing extremely. Top quality breast compressions continue to be the core. That claimed, standards tighten up around technique and concerns every five years or so as new data gathers. The styles you can anticipate in existing CPR training in Newcastle consist of:

image

    Emphasis on minimal stops briefly. The hands-off time in between compressions and defibrillation is important. Pauses should be as brief as feasible when placing pads or switching compressors. Compressions initially, aid quickly. If you are alone with a smart phone, activate audio speaker, telephone call 000, and start compressions. If others are present, delegate early. One telephone calls, one obtains the AED, one begins compressions. Depth and price concentrated responses. For adults, roughly one third of chest deepness, which is about 5 to 6 centimeters, at a price near 100 to 120 per min. Real-time responses devices on manikins help you hit this range. Ventilation materialism. For trained companies with a barrier device, 30 compressions to 2 breaths remains standard. If you can not aerate successfully, do hands-only mouth-to-mouth resuscitation as opposed to hold-up compressions. AED usage earlier and smoother. Earlier add-on, clear pad positioning, and no touching throughout analysis and shock is pierced. Modern AEDs are made for lay use and provide detailed voice prompts.

Common errors and just how to deal with them

I seldom see somebody that can not find out mouth-to-mouth resuscitation. I typically see routines that make great intentions much less effective. Shallow compressions cover the listing. Individuals are afraid pressing also hard. The breast requires to compress a third of its depth on an adult, approximately 5 to 6 first aid courses in newcastle centimeters, with full recoil between presses. Partial recoil reduces blood flow.

Breaths create hold-up. If you choose to ventilate, prepare your seal rapidly, tilt the head correctly, and supply each breath over one 2nd just enough to see the chest surge. Say goodbye to. Overventilating or stopping as well lengthy minimizes perfusion. If you do not have a barrier tool, or if the scenario is messy, hands-only CPR is acceptable and much better than waiting.

AED pads are another stumbling point. Position them according to the representation, one high ideal upper body and the various other left side listed below the underarm for grownups. Do not location over a drug patch, and if the upper body is damp, wipe it briefly before connecting. Hair can disrupt pad get in touch with. The majority of AED sets lug a razor for a fast shave of a little location if needed.

Finally, people remain on scene after paramedics show up and maintain talking. Hand over plainly, after that go back. The group requires area, and the person needs a controlled environment. In the adrenaline of the minute, a tranquility, accurate handover is gold: collapse time, compressions started time, AED connected time, shocks delivered count. If you have a spectator maintaining a straightforward note on a phone, these times help.

The role of public AEDs in Newcastle

AED coverage is boosting. Shopping centers, train stations, libraries, and sports clubs across Newcastle and Lake Macquarie have actually added systems in noticeable closets. Understanding where your nearest AED sits becomes part of being prepared. Throughout a refresher, fitness instructors frequently imitate the access while compressions proceed. If you exercise that handoff a couple of times, you will not break rhythm when it matters.

AEDs are designed to be risk-free. If the tool encourages no shock, proceed compressions. If it suggests shock, guarantee no person touches the client before delivering. Voice triggers guide you.
